AkijBashir Group seeks to appoint an Executive/Senior Executive (Organizational Development and Effectiveness) to join its Group HR team. If you are passionate about HR & people management and eager to work in a multicultural work environment, we encourage you to apply.
Key Responsibilities:
Formulate drafts of various policies and SOPs by gathering AS IS data, and prepare comparative statements to align proposed requirements with existing practices
Ensure that approved policies and SOPs are properly circulated, explained, and understood by all employees
Standardize and implement various approval formats to maintain consistency across all clusters
Conduct data analysis to identify trends and generate insightful reports that support data-driven decision-making
Follow up and coordinate with relevant stakeholders to ensure deadlines are met and deliverables are achieved
Execute HR project-based tasks and ensure their timely handover to designated personnel for seamless transition and implementation in the operational phase
Any other job assigned by the supervisor
